Config file for Windows version

Why are the config files not in the same folder as the executable? What is the purpose of having it set in the user folder? This makes it inconvenient when trying to make it portable.

Maybe I am missing something. Is it possible to provide an option to make Syncthing “portable”?

I don’t think this is best practice for anything, Windows or not?

Yep, give it -home <path to where you want your config>.

Thanks for the help.

